DESCRIPTION:Seeking to escape the escalating anti-trans violence and persecution in conservative areas of the country\, scores of trans+ folk and their families and loved ones (aka “transplants”) resettled in Seattle in the last year with help via TRACTION’s Project Open Arms. Even more arrived via our friends at KOI — and who knows how many came by other means. A successful move like that isn’t just getting your body to a new place or the logistics it takes to get there. It’s also about connecting with new faces\, making friends\, feeling included\, and building community. \nTRACTION\, KOI\, and Seattle’s LGBTQ+ Center invite recent transplants\, along with local relocation volunteers & couch Network hosts\, to a new monthly gathering. Come enjoy a free meal and get to know your new neighbors. \nCapacity will be limited and security is critical\, so it’s important to RSVP.
